Two questions for all of you experienced diamond people out there :)

First, what is the depth and spread of a cushion supposed to be? Or is that another one of those "whatever looks good to your eye" things?

Second, has anyone had experience with Henri Daussi? We are looking at a setting (that I LOVE) from him. Any advice?

Unfortunately, there is no formula as yet for cushions that you can use, which will give you a well cut diamond, I wish it were that simple!  Also it is weight distribution that is important with fancy shapes as to where extra weight can be hidden, as well as the depth.  Of course the depth percent is important to know, but it doesn't necessarily relate to the face up spread as it does with rounds.

Your best bet is to work with a vendor like Mark at www.engagementringsdirect.com or Jon at www.goodoldgold.com if you are searching for a cushion, one which can supply detailed photos which are so important when buying a cushion, and also ASET images if possible.
